Різниця між таблицею та поданням

Таблиця проти перегляду

База даних - це цифровий набір організованих даних або інформації, який може зберігатися в пам'яті комп'ютера або інших пристроях зберігання даних. Він був розроблений таким чином, що користувачі можуть зберігати та отримувати доступ до них у великій кількості. У базі даних є кілька об'єктів, які зберігають, відображають та аналізують велику кількість інформації. Microsoft SQL надає об'єкти бази даних, такі як збережені процедури, користувачі, функції, таблиці та представлення даних.

У таблицях зберігаються дані, які використовуються в додатках та звітах. Вони розроблені у рядках, стовпцях та полях. Вони можуть мати лише певну кількість стовпців, але можуть містити якомога більше рядків. Реляційні бази даних використовують кілька таблиць для зберігання пов'язаних даних та записів.

Дані в таблицях можуть або не можуть фізично зберігатися в базі даних. Існує два типи таблиць, а саме; об'єктні таблиці, які використовують тип об'єкта для визначення стовпця і зберігають екземпляри визначеного об'єкта, і реляційну таблицю, яка містить основні дані користувача у реляційній базі даних.

З іншого боку, View - це запит, який використовується як таблиця, яка може бути пов'язана з іншою таблицею. Це список декількох записів у форматі таблиці, які використовуються для даних, які часто запитуються. При запиті імен та адрес, які знаходяться в різних таблицях, можна використовувати представлення даних. Це віртуальна таблиця, яка збирається з даних у базі даних. Для зміни даних, що зберігаються в базі даних, також змінилися б дані, представлені у поданні. Він може включати кілька таблиць в одну віртуальну таблицю і приховувати тонкощі даних. Для зберігання даних йому потрібно лише трохи місця, оскільки база даних зберігає лише її визначення, а не ті дані, які вона містить або представляє. Він також забезпечує безпеку даних та обмежує показ даних. Його можна використовувати для створення абстракцій.

Рядки в огляді та таблиці не впорядковані, але їх можна сортувати та запитувати. Перегляди можна оновлювати, а також дозволяє запитувати дані з віддалених джерел. Запити, які суперечать думкам, повинні бути змінені.
Підсумок:

1.Таблиця - це об'єкт бази даних, який використовується для зберігання даних, що використовуються у звітах та програмах, а представлення - це також об'єкт бази даних, який використовується як таблиця та запит, який може бути пов'язаний з іншими таблицями.
2.Таблиця розроблена з обмеженою кількістю стовпців і необмеженою кількістю рядків, тоді як подання розроблено як віртуальна таблиця, витягнута з бази даних.
3. Вид може включати кілька таблиць в одну віртуальну таблицю, тоді як для зберігання пов'язаних даних і записів потрібно кілька таблиць.
4.Перегляд використовується для запиту певних даних, що містяться в декількох різних таблицях, тоді як таблиця містить основні дані користувача та містить примірники визначеного об'єкта.
5.Часто запитуються дані можуть бути доступні в представленні даних, а зміна даних у базі даних також змінює дані, показані у представленні даних, що не так у таблиці.